I had the same issue. It could be related to multiple effects happening at once.

In the wobbly windows plugin, disable the actions on window map and
focus (I believe it defaults to "Shiver", set it to "None".)

You should not need to change anything in the move plugin.

Of course this doesn't fix the underlying issue..
